'Up, down, up, down.' Ruthie sang the rhythmic beat of the trot in her head as she slowly began to post. Her legs were shaking madly, and her palms were already becoming clammy as she clutched the reins tightly. Archer's ears moved like antenna's, twitching and quivering at the slightest noise. Her powerful legs struck the ground with great force, and her sleek coat gleamed with each movement of her hoof. Ruthie took a deep, soothing breath to calm her squirmy insides, and began to message her inside rein with her ring finger. She gently applied the aid of her inside leg as she did this, and rolled her shoulders back. As if on cue, and much to Ruthie's pleasure, Archer's head dropped into an elegant frame. A smile crept up Ruthie's face. Archer was actually behaving! As the couple rounded the corner, a slight flutter of hope slowly began to rise in the pit of Ruthie's stomach. She actually might have a change of making it out of the try-outs alive! With a new found hope steadily burning, Ruthie directed her horse with courage.
A few moments later, Clover directed them to signal for a canter. She wanted the transition to be quick and precise. Ruthie slowly brought her outside leg back, and gently leaned back. She softly clucked her tongue against the roof of her mouth. Archer's delicate ears twitched slightly as she lunged into canter. Right away, Ruthie's body fell into the motion of the four-beat gait. It was a silky smooth rhythm that rocked the very pits of her soul. Suddenly, out of the blue, Archer gave a wild snort and leaped into a frenzy of bucks and kicks. Ruthie, taken-aback by her sudden actions, was thrown back into the saddle. Acting quickly, she slid her hands up the reins, and got a firm hold of her mouth. She sat stiffly in the saddle, and jammed her heels down. As calmly as she could, she cried, "Easy, easy!" Archer tossed her head angrily, and beat her hooves forcefully on the dirt path. But, as if against her will, she slowed down to a working trot. Ruthie heaved a sigh. Maybe this wasn't going to be as easy as she thought!
